The pink wire you want is coming from pin "E" of the connector. The other pink wire goes to the trans temp sensor.
In short you want the pin in the middle row all by itself. Double check the wire for 12 volts before you tie it all up and take the car off jack stands.

If you have a pink wire in the old A4 connector, simply connect a volt meter to the pink wire, and to ground, and verify that it is in fact +12V switched power. Shouldn't be all that hard.
On the brown wire, you could pull the harness connector off the PCM, and do a continuity check from pin 6 on the connector to the end of the brown wire on the old A4 connector.
